The historical heritage of Isle-sur-la-Sorgue illustrates the importance of the city within the Comtat Venaissin in the 14th century. Colored with greenery and water, this island town nestled at the foot of the Vaucluse plateau is crisscrossed by several canals fed by the Sorgue. In the past, inhabitants primarily lived off fishing (up to 15,000 crayfish per day!), while the large water wheels powered numerous silk factories in the 18th century, and later paper mills in the 19th century. Some wheels still turn, but now solely for the pleasure of passersby. Today, Isle-sur-la-Sorgue enjoys international renown due to the large number of antique dealers spread throughout the city (especially open on weekends) and the numerous art and painting galleries.

Gordes
Departure for a Panoramic Stop and Walking Tour in Gordes
Gordes can pride itself on being one of the most beautiful villages in France, with its cobblestone streets winding between tall houses, built right into the rock, clinging to its slopes that breathe a thousand stories and legends.

The Domaine was established in 1990 from a farm and its 8 hectares located at the foot of the village of Ménerbes. In 2022, the estate was taken over by a couple who are dedicated to preserving the environment and advocate for respect for the land by adopting eco-friendly techniques such as horse plowing, eco-grazing in the vineyards, and installing beehives. The estate has been practicing organic agriculture since 2016 and is certified HVE (High Environmental Value). Today, the vineyard totals 40 hectares of vines ranging from 15 to 75 years old, mainly located in the municipality of Ménerbes, on the north slope of the Luberon.
